A Buyer's Guide to FHA Loans in Virginia
Virginia homebuyers looking for financing options often consider FHA loans. These government-backed finances offer attractive interest rates and relaxed lending criteria, making them a popular choice for first-time buyers or those with less-than-perfect credit.
An FHA loan is insured by the Federal Housing Administration (FHA), which minimizes risk for lenders. This allows mortgage providers to offer more budget-friendly terms compared to conventional loans.
To qualify for an FHA loan in Virginia, buyers must meet certain criteria. These typically include a minimum credit score, debt-to-income ratio (DTI), and down payment amount.
Virginia's real estate market can be demanding, so having a clear understanding of the FHA loan process is crucial. Working with an experienced lender who specializes in FHA loans can guide you through each step, from application to closing.
Keep in mind that while FHA loans offer benefits, they also come with certain fees. These include an upfront mortgage insurance premium (UFMIP) and an annual mortgage insurance premium (MIP).
Before making a decision, it's important to explore the various FHA loan programs available in Virginia and compare interest rates, terms, and fees from different lenders.

Benefits of an FHA Loan for First-Time Homebuyers in Virginia
FHA loans offer numerous benefits to first-time homebuyers navigating the thriving Virginia real estate market. These government-backed loans require lower down payments compared to conventional mortgages, making homeownership more achievable for those with limited savings.
Furthermore, FHA loans are known for their relaxed credit score requirements, offering opportunities to first-time buyers who may yet met the stricter criteria of conventional lenders. This accessibility can be particularly helpful for individuals constructing their credit history.
One perk of FHA loans is that they often have lower closing costs compared to other loan types, helping buyers reduce upfront expenses. This can be a considerable factor for first-time homebuyers who are already facing the costs associated with purchasing a home.
Finally, FHA loans offer assurance to lenders through mortgage insurance premiums (MIP), which offset potential losses. This mitigates lender risk and allows them to provide more lenient loan terms to borrowers, ultimately making homeownership a more attainable goal for first-time buyers in Virginia.
